The Multistrada 1100 S is Italian born and bred, with its development taking place on the winding mountain roads and city streets of Italy. It is truly a real-world sports bike that delivers high performance while also providing a comfortable riding position and a high-level of practicality and versatility. Casey Stoner's trick kart

Thu, 19 Apr 2012

The other day Casey Stoner tweeted this shot of this factory looking kart, which the reigning champion has been customising during the MotoGP downtime between Qatar and Jerez. Stoner became hooked on karting after taking part in the ice-race at the Ducati/Ferrari Vrooom event in 2009, beating F1 driver Felipe Massa in the process. Not only a hobby, Casey uses karting for training, as the Australian says there are physical benefits as well as to his reflexes.

Brown, Folkard and Fry wrap up 848 Challenge finale

Fri, 05 Oct 2012

The Ducati 848 Challenge 2012 season drew to a close at the home of British Motorsport this weekend as the riders took to the fantastic Silverstone GP circuit.   Going into the weekend only one out of the top three championship positions had been decided, as Robbie Brown (Ducati Manchester) was crowned champion at Donington Park two weeks ago. This left plenty to play for, as James Folkard (Minards Pavlou Solicitors), Mike Edwards (OHLINS @ P&H Motorcycles) and Darren Fry (Hirebase Ducati Coventry) were all in with a shot of taking the runner up spot.
